- The distance between M. Calamita, Italy and Aleksandrov-Gaj, Russia is approximately 3,001 km or 1,865 mi.
- To reach M. Calamita in this distance one would set out from Aleksandrov-Gaj bearing 268.9°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ach M. Calamita bearing 240.7° or WSW .
- M. Calamita has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Aleksandrov-Gaj has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- The average temperature is 7.4 °C (13.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.3 °C (34.7°F) less in M. Calamita.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 326 mm (12.8 in) more which is equivalent to 326 l/m² (8 US gal/ft²) or 3,260,000 l/ha (348,516 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.4° higher in M. Calamita than in Aleksandrov-Gaj.
